Upon entering Earth's orbit, Joy will begin to float freely inside the
SpaceX Dragon spacecraft
, signaling to Shukla and his international crew that they have officially entered the realm of zero gravity. This charming tradition dates back to Soviet cosmonaut Yuri Gagarin in 1961, who carried a small doll to indicate weightlessness. Since then, a "Zero-G indicator" plushie has become a staple of SpaceX missions, with astronauts selecting companions ranging from "Buzz Lightyear" to various Earth-themed characters.
Why a Swan? A Symbol of Unity, Grace, and Indian Heritage
The choice of a swan as the Axiom-4 mission's Zero-G toy was a collective decision by all four international astronauts – from India, Hungary, Poland, and the USA. However, for Group Captain Shukla and India, the swan resonates with a deeper cultural significance. In Indian tradition, the swan is the revered vehicle of Goddess Saraswati, embodying purity, knowledge, and artistic grace. Beyond its cultural ties, the swan universally symbolizes resilience and purity.

Mission Axiom-4: Pushing India's Space Odyssey
The Axiom-4 mission marks the fourth private astronaut expedition to the ISS, spearheaded by Axiom Space commander and former NASA astronaut Peggy Whitson. The international crew also includes Slawosz Uznanski from Poland and Tibor Kapu from Hungary. Group Captain Shukla's role as pilot underscores the high responsibility and precision required for this historic flight aboard a SpaceX Falcon 9 rocket.

Weather Holds, Technical Hurdles Cleared
Beyond weather, SpaceX also tackled pre-launch technical challenges. William Gerstenmaier, SpaceX's VP of Build and Flight Reliability, confirmed a liquid oxygen leak on the Falcon 9 booster, now mitigated with an installed purge system. A thrust vector control system issue was also resolved. A recent "dry dress rehearsal" for the full launch simulation proceeded smoothly, building confidence for the new launch window.

Adding to the mission's significance, this flight marks the inaugural journey for an updated version of the Dragon spacecraft. Gerstenmaier highlighted improvements in food processing, propulsion, and crew stair security, stating, "This isn't just the same old Dragon." The Falcon 9 booster itself is on its second flight, contributing to SpaceX's busy year, which has already seen three Dragon missions in just 38 days.

NASA Layoffs: Is Trump's budget cut approved by Congress? NASA asks employees to opt for early retirement, deferred resignation, or voluntary separation. Here's last date and terms of departure
NASA has introduced a range of new programs aimed at reducing its workforce. These changes follow proposed budget cuts by the Trump administration for the 2026 fiscal year. The programs are voluntary and give employees multiple options for leaving the agency. New Programs for Staff Exit NASA sent memos to employees on June 9, announcing early retirement, deferred resignation, and voluntary separation incentive options. These programs are part of a larger workforce reduction effort. The goal is to reduce the number of NASA employees significantly by 2026. This proposal aims to lower the employee count from 17,391 to 11,853, a 32% drop. The proposed budget is still under review by Congress and not yet finalized. Deadline for Employee Decisions NASA has asked employees to decide by July 25 if they want to participate in the new staff reduction options. Those who opt into the Deferred Resignation Program will likely stop working soon afterward but will continue to receive pay until January 9, 2026. Take a look: View this post on Instagram A post shared by Sanjay Dutt (@duttsanjay) Sunil Dutt's glorious life and filmography Sunil Dutt was a renowned Indian actor, producer, director, and politician whose career spanned several decades, leaving a lasting impact on Bollywood. He began his career as a radio host and made his film debut with Railway Platform (1955). However, it was his compelling performance in Mother India (1957) that brought him widespread acclaim. Notably, in this film, he played the rebellious son of Nargis, whom he later married. Dutt was known for his versatility and gravitas, featuring in a wide array of films such as Sujata (1959), Mujhe Jeene Do (1963), Waqt (1965), Padosan (1968), and Reshma Aur Shera (1971), which he also directed. His roles often combined charm with intensity, addressing social issues and showcasing emotional depth. In addition to his film career, he was respected for his humanitarian work and political involvement. He served as a Member of Parliament and was the Minister of Youth Affairs and Sports. Despite facing personal and professional challenges, including the loss of his wife Nargis and the difficulties related to his son Sanjay Dutt, Sunil Dutt remained a symbol of dignity and resilience.
